For purists seeking tea directly from the Wuyi Mountain Reserve or specific villages like Tongmu, these sources offer specialized "Zheng Shan" varieties.
Lapsang Souchong, a black tea famous for its distinct pine-smoked aroma, is available through specialty tea merchants, major grocery retailers, and authentic Chinese producers. Because high-end authentic "Zheng Shan Xiao Zhong" from the Wuyi Mountains is rare and expensive, many accessible versions use varied smoking techniques or unsmoked "Jin Jun Mei" styles.
